Property Description
Welcome to this spacious convertible three-bedroom duplex on one of the Upper East Side's most coveted blocks.
This charming pre-war home is rich in character, featuring exposed brick, a wood-burning fireplace, nearly 10-foot ceilings, custom built-ins, and beautiful hardwood floors throughout.
Currently configured as a two-bedroom, two-bath residence with a flexible third space, the layout offers exceptional versatility. Whether used as an additional bedroom, den, dining room, or second living area, the home easily adapts to your needs.
The primary bedroom faces south and enjoys abundant natural light throughout the day. Generously proportioned, it comfortably accommodates a king-sized bed and features both a large closet and built-in storage.
Downstairs, the second bedroom is equally spacious, with room for a king-sized bed, a closet, and the added convenience of in-unit laundry. The washer and dryer are full-sized, brand new, side-by-side, and vents out.
Both bathrooms are well-maintained and outfitted with brand new Toto toilets and excellent storage.
This is a well-run, self-managed cooperative with no underlying mortgage and attractive maintenance for the neighborhood. The building's exterior has been meticulously maintained, enhancing its curb appeal along this picturesque block. Please note: no pets allowed.
East 78th Street is widely regarded as one of the Upper East Side's best blocks, offering a perfect balance of charm and convenience. Just moments from your doorstep are beloved neighborhood staples like Orwasher's, the century-old artisan bakery known for its exceptional sourdough, as well as Agata & Valentina. A wide array of restaurants, cafés, and boutiques are all nearby.
Transportation is seamless, with easy access to the Q train on 2nd Avenue on both 72nd and 86th Streets, the 6 train at 77th Street and Lexington Avenue, and the 4/5/6 at 86th Street.
